Presentation of responses<br />

Responses to the questionnaire are presented in each of the six categories. It is important to note that the<br />

survey was not intended to identify every mental health promotion programme in Northern Ireland,<br />

depending as it did on self-selection rather than on a restricted representative sample. It is also important<br />

to note that this information will be updated in the future.<br />

Not all responses received have been included in this edition, either because of missing information,<br />

because some have not yet started or because the implications for mental health promotion were not made<br />

clear. Several responses indicated more than one category. However one category only was allocated to each<br />

project for the purpose of providing exemplars. A few projects did not indicate any category, and were<br />

therefore placed in a category based on the information provided. Contacts have been identified in each<br />

case for further information.<br />
